Abstract :
Experimental equipment has been developed which adapts the Rake concept to tropospheric scatter. This equipment enables experimental tests of multipath diversity effectiveness for communications. Its delay-resolution capabilities and circuit stability also allow effective use of the equipment for novel propagation research. The underlying concepts and equipment design are described, along with initial propagation test results.
